const input = document.querySelector("input").value; // add an ID or class or something, this is just for demo purposes const [ seperated1, seperated2 ] = input.replace(/g/g, "").split(" - "); // First regular expression removes all "g"s from the string. Split turns the string into an array using " - " as a delimiter console.log(seperated1, seperated2);Utilizar este:
let val = '1475g - 1500g'; val = val.replace(/g| /g, ''); val = val.split('-'); console.log(val[0], val[1]);
